http://www.adolphus.me.uk/Study_Skills/chapter4/section4_5/Objectivity.htm WebDec 9, 2024 · The word objective describes information that’s based on verifiable facts. Objective truth can be verified by a third party, regardless of who the third party is. For example, the sentence “The temperature outside is around 10°C” is an objective statement, because that statement will be equally true no matter who says it. norman thomas state farm agent https://leighlenzmeier.com

WebFormality, Objectivity, and Clarity. This Survival Guide focuses on the second feature, objectivity. Writing in an objective or impersonal way enables you to sound more convincing or persuasive to academic audiences.
